In-Text Secondly, if the lawes and ordinances giuen by Moses, who was but a seruant, might not bee abrogate, chopped or chaunged of any mortall creature without the displeasure of the Almightie, much lesse then those lawes and ordinances of the Lord Iesus being the chiefe Lord and ruler ouer all.
